Job description:

Key Responsibilities To participate in the daytime AMHP rota by being called upon to undertake Mental Health Act assessments in the capacity of Approved Mental Health Professional. The service operates 9.00 a.m. and 5.00 p.m. daily although there may be occasions when assessments fall outside these times To provide a range of interventions to individuals who may be experiencing mental health crisis specific to service user need and where required make legally defensible decisions about the need for compulsory detention under the Mental Health Act. Be able to undertake complex risk assessments using specialist knowledge and experience of managing high risk and complex situations and make evidence based decisions about emergency responses to the needs of service users and carers as assessed within the context of Mental Health Act assessments and mental health crises. To adhere to the standards of proficiency set by the Health and Care Professional Council so that registration can be maintained and learning or development needs are duly accounted for in supervision and appraisals. Ideally, the applicant needs to be currently warranted and working as AMHPs so that they can be warranted by Hackney in a timely manner.
